Oregon Department of Human Services (DHS) Fails ALL Federal Child Care Standards::
SALEM, Ore. -- State officials knew eight years ago of deficiencies in their child welfare programs and failed to address any of the significant issues, according to a report sent to federal assessors last month. The 2008 review found the Oregon Department of Human Services below standard in 11 of 13 federal child care assessment categories. DHS is required to assess its child care programs about every six years. Top DHS officials would have been aware of the 2008 review — including the director, deputy director and all division managers — said spokeswoman Andrea Cantu-Schomus. The report shows that DHS: Is below standard for child maltreatment with more than 540 substantiated cases of child abuse from from 2013 to 2015, Below standards for recurrent child maltreatment, with nearly 10 percent of abused children experiencing repeated maltreatment, Does not conduct sufficient investigations of reported of child abuse, Does not handle cases in a timely manner with only 50 percent addressed within time limits, and some cases receiving timely responses 15.5 percent of the time.
